The Museum’s Fascinating History
Located in the restored Municipal Theatre, the Dalí Theatre-Museum stands as a tribute to the legacy of the 20th-century artist. The building, once damaged during the Civil War, has been transformed into a vibrant cultural landmark reflecting Dalí’s unique vision.
